Output 2d1a806fbdda7e6d59411d940900495bfd37b1d301f6f4a24b0c64873ab06e17:0

value
22081128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39867f3000f0b9294f16e27b16bcb1ead6ebe888 OP_EQUALVERIFY OP_CHECKSIG
address
16FAdwPFbqbEXeHK2QFnBsgD8EctfKFihg
transaction
2d1a806fbdda7e6d59411d940900495bfd37b1d301f6f4a24b0c64873ab06e17
confirmations
579566
spent
true